ThingWorx アプリケーション構築の最良事例一覧
IoT アプリケーションを構築する際には以下の最良事例を考慮してください。
プロジェクトにエンティティを含めます。1 つのアプリケーションにプロジェクトを 1 つだけ使用します。
モデルタグを使用してエンティティをタグ付けします。
拡張機能のすべてのエンティティを編集不可能にします。
すべてのユーザーインタフェースラベルにローカライズトークンを作成します。
JavaScript を使用してサービスを実装します。
Thing Shape を使用してサービスおよびプロパティを定義します。
エンティティ名、プロパティ、およびサービスに一意の名前空間プレフィックスを使用します。
エンティティに組織とユーザーグループを定義して、表示権限およびアクセス許可を設定します。
大規模なアプリケーションおよびソリューションを小さな拡張機能に分割します。
マッシュアップでのサービスの実行に固定のアセット Thing を使用しないでください。アセット Thing を動的に選択または検索した後で、そのサービスを実行する必要があります。
* 
問題のあるシナリオを回避するため、ヘルパーまたはマネージャ Thing のサービスを使用します。これらのサービスは入力パラメータとしてアセット Thing の名前をとり、これは後でマッシュアップで使用されます。